服务器如何搭建网站,从零开始,详细解析服务器搭建与网站部署全过程
- 综合资讯
- 2024-11-25 03:08:18
- 2

服务器搭建网站全过程解析,涵盖从零开始,包括选择服务器、安装操作系统、配置网络、部署网站应用、数据库设置及安全加固等关键步骤,确保网站稳定运行。...
服务器搭建网站全过程解析,涵盖从零开始,包括选择服务器、安装操作系统、配置网络、部署网站应用、数据库设置及安全加固等关键步骤,确保网站稳定运行。
随着互联网的快速发展,网站已经成为企业、个人展示形象、拓展业务的重要平台,搭建一个网站并非易事,需要掌握一定的服务器搭建与网站部署知识,本文将详细解析服务器搭建与网站部署全过程,帮助读者轻松掌握这一技能。
服务器搭建前的准备工作
1、确定服务器类型
根据实际需求,选择合适的服务器类型,目前市场上主要有物理服务器、虚拟服务器和云服务器三种类型,物理服务器性能稳定,但成本较高;虚拟服务器成本低,易于扩展;云服务器弹性好,按需付费。
2、购买服务器及域名
根据服务器类型和需求,选择合适的服务器供应商,购买服务器及域名,购买服务器时,要关注服务器的硬件配置、网络带宽、价格等因素,域名则是网站的唯一标识,需要注册一个简洁、易记的域名。
3、购买SSL证书
为了提高网站的安全性,建议购买SSL证书,SSL证书可以加密网站数据传输,防止信息泄露。
4、准备网站源代码
在服务器搭建之前,需要准备好网站的源代码,包括HTML、CSS、JavaScript、PHP、MySQL等文件。
服务器搭建步骤
1、服务器硬件安装
根据服务器类型,进行硬件安装,如果是物理服务器,需要安装CPU、内存、硬盘、网络设备等硬件;如果是虚拟服务器,则由供应商完成硬件安装。
2、操作系统安装
在服务器上安装操作系统,如Linux、Windows等,这里以Linux为例,介绍安装步骤:
(1)制作启动U盘,选择适合的Linux发行版,如CentOS、Ubuntu等。
(2)将U盘插入服务器,重启服务器并设置为从U盘启动。
(3)按照提示完成操作系统安装。
3、配置网络
(1)设置IP地址:根据实际需求,为服务器设置静态IP地址。
(2)配置防火墙:关闭不必要的端口,开启必要的端口,如80、443等。
(3)配置DNS:将域名解析到服务器的IP地址。
4、安装网站运行环境
(1)安装Apache/Nginx:作为Web服务器,安装Apache或Nginx。
(2)安装PHP:安装PHP环境,以便运行PHP代码。
(3)安装MySQL:安装MySQL数据库,用于存储网站数据。
5、部署网站
(1)上传网站源代码:将网站源代码上传到服务器。
(2)配置Web服务器:根据实际需求,配置Apache或Nginx,如设置网站根目录、虚拟主机等。
(3)配置数据库:创建数据库,并将网站数据导入数据库。
(4)测试网站:访问网站,检查网站是否正常运行。
服务器优化与维护
1、服务器优化
(1)优化Web服务器:调整Web服务器配置,提高网站访问速度。
(2)优化数据库:对数据库进行优化,提高查询效率。
(3)优化网络:优化服务器网络配置,提高网络带宽。
2、服务器维护
(1)定期备份:定期备份服务器数据,以防数据丢失。
(2)监控系统:安装监控系统,实时监控服务器状态。
(3)更新系统:定期更新操作系统和软件,提高服务器安全性。
通过以上步骤,我们可以成功搭建一个网站,这只是网站搭建的基础知识,实际操作中还需根据具体情况调整,希望本文能对您有所帮助,祝您在服务器搭建与网站部署过程中一切顺利!
本文链接:https://zhitaoyun.cn/1055080.html
发表评论